the northern part of the Midwest is referred to as the rust belt because of its cold temperatures and generous precipitation​
ahrayia [7]

The Rust Belt is an informal region referring to a an area that has experienced dramatic decline in its industry.

Explanation:

The Rust Belt is an area, or rather informal region in the United States. It has nothing to do with the climate characteristics of the area, but it got its name because of the drastic decline of the industry. This ''region'' is not only occupying territory in the northern Midwest, but it stretches as east as New York, and as west as Wisconsin.

Staring from the 80's, a belt like area along the northern part of the United States started to have sharp decline in its industry. The once powerful industrial centers suffered greatly, as the decline of the industry had major impact on the economy, lot of population moved out, and the places stagnated or even degraded. The most affected area was the Great Lakes region. The states where the ''Rust Belt'' goes through are:

  • New York
  • Pennsylvania
  • West Virginia
  • Ohio
  • Indiana
  • Michigan
  • Illinois
  • Iowa
  • Wisconsin
